Trekkies can rest easy tonight, as JJ Abrams has reportedly agreed to return as director for Star Trek 2.
Abrams, who directed the recent sci-fi hit “Super 8” has been meeting with writers (including fellow Lost alum David Lindelof) to start work on the Star Trek script.
However fans may be sad to hear that the film will not make it’s release date deadline of next summer. Instead, G.I. Joe 2 will take it’s place, and Star Trek may not hit theaters until late 2012 or summer 2013.
The original cast, including Chris Pine, Zachary Quinto, and Zoe Saldana are all set to reprise their roles in the upcoming sequel.
